Thrivent Financial for Lutherans lessened its position in Waters Corporation (NYSE:WAT – Free Report) by 21.3% in the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 277,051 shares of the medical instruments supplier’s stock after selling 75,008 shares during the period. Thrivent Financial for Lutherans owned about 0.47% of Waters worth $96,702,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Waters Company Profile
Waters Corporation provides analytical workflow solutions in Asia, the Americas, and Europe. It operates through two segments: Waters and TA. The company designs, manufactures, sells, and services high and ultra-performance liquid chromatography, as well as mass spectrometry (MS) technology systems and support products, including chromatography columns, other consumable products, and post-warranty service plans.
